Output 38ca00d9504961387043eaaf154e99c9c89876f4a66e4f1806d79dee5a2d3128:1

value
91225664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a9135803af63d2a0e7ab03abee543cf4152cb7f OP_EQUAL
address
372h4y4AR5qJ2UNjVbnU1brfcZwDwmrxup
transaction
38ca00d9504961387043eaaf154e99c9c89876f4a66e4f1806d79dee5a2d3128
spent
true